Closing Date: 05/11/2020 at 09:00 Interviews: 12 November 2020 Information about the school Broomhill Bank School is a highly successfulcoeducational special school, situated on two sites, for students aged 11-19with an Education, Health and Care Plan relating to Communication, Interactionand Learning difficulties. Broomhill Bank School (West) is situated in Rusthallnear Tunbridge Wells, and is the administrative centre for the school as awhole. Broomhill Bank (North) opened in September 2015 and is situated in Hextable,near Swanley, which hosts our residential provision. We are members of the collaborative group of KentSpecial Schools, KSENT, comprised of 24 special schools across Kent. Broomhill Bank School is the host school for theSpecialist Teaching and Learning Outreach Service within the Tunbridge WellsDistrict. We deploy this resource to support children and young people withSEND in mainstream schools and Early Years settings across the Tunbridge WellsDistrict.
